Posts by a Twitter @Nameko_new is being talked about among Japanese Internet users. It is about "small umbrellas that her late grandmother had left".
And here are the umbrellas:
Source: @Nameko_new
Source: @Nameko_new
Source: @Nameko_new
These umbrellas that my grandmother had made out of cigarette boxes are so cute! Having a cherry-blossom pattern is amazing too, don't you think!
That's right - these are made out of cigarette boxes!
Apparently, @Nameko_new found these umbrellas when she was cleaning up the property of the deceased grandmother. Because of the reaction she received, she says she wanted to tell her grandmother about this.
